We're living in a Simulated Universe? Are you sure?

Pondering about the nature of the universe is always fun, isn't it? It's one of the cool things science fiction writers get to do.

So, this Oxford philosopher "proves," mathematically, that either you're living in a simulated universe, or else the world is going to end soon. Wow, that's bleak, no? Fortunately there are some flaws in his logic, leading to some even more fascinating ideas, which I've played with for fun in an article that was originally printed in the Bulletin of the Science Fiction and Fantasy Writers of America.

Enjoy it before the universe ends! :)
